Key Features of the HPE R9L64A Switch
The HPE R9L64A switch comes equipped with an impressive array of features that make it a valuable addition to any network infrastructure. Here’s a breakdown of its key features:
48 Ports of Gigabit Ethernet
The HPE R9L64A offers a total of 48 Ethernet ports, providing high-speed connectivity for your network devices. These ports support data transfer rates of 1 Gbps, which is essential for bandwidth-intensive applications and the smooth operation of modern networks.
Power Over Ethernet Plus (PoE+)
One of the standout features of the HPE R9L64A switch is its Power Over Ethernet Plus (PoE+) support. PoE+ allows the switch to deliver both data and electrical power to PoE-compatible devices, such as IP cameras, wireless access points, and VoIP phones, over the Ethernet cables. This eliminates the need for separate power sources, simplifying cable management and reducing costs.
4 SFP+ (Small Form-Factor Pluggable Plus) Ports
In addition to the Gigabit Ethernet ports, the HPE R9L64A switch features 4 SFP+ ports. These high-speed, hot-swappable ports are ideal for connecting to fiber optic networks or creating high-performance network links, offering flexibility in network design.
Layer 3 Management Capabilities
The switch supports Layer 3 management, which enables advanced routing and network segmentation. With Layer 3 capabilities, the switch can make intelligent routing decisions based on IP addresses, optimizing network traffic and enhancing network performance.
Rack-Mountable and Space-Saving 1U Design
The HPE R9L64A switch is rack-mountable, fitting into a standard 19-inch rack. Its 1U (1 rack unit) height saves valuable data center or network closet space, making it a compact and efficient networking solution.

General Information of 48 Port FlexNetwork 5140 HI Switch
- Manufacturer: HPE
- Part Number or SKU# R9L64A
- Product Line: FlexNetwork
- Product Series: 5140 HI
- Product Name: FlexNetwork 5140 48G PoE+ 4SFP+ HI Switch
- Device Type: L3 Managed Switch
Technical Information of Layer 3 Managed Switch
- Enclosure Type: Rack-mountable 1U with side-to-back airflow
- Switching Type: Gigabit Ethernet
- Number of Ports: 48
- Ports Details : 48 x 10/100/1000 + 4 x 10 Gigabit SFP+
- Power Over Ethernet (PoE): PoE+
Performance of Gigabit Ethernet PoE+ Switch
- Latency (1000 Mbps): 5 µs
- Latency (10 Gbps): 3 µs
- Throughput: 180 Mpps
- Routing/Switching Capacity: 336 Gbps
- MAC Address Table Size: 32K entries
- Jumbo Frame Support: 9KB
- Routing Protocol: OSPF, RIP-1, RIP-2, IGMP, VRRP, OSPFv2, OSPFv3, VRRPE, Static IPv4 Routing, Static IPv6 Routing, CIDR
- Remote Management Protocol: SNMP 1, RMON 1, RMON 2, RMON 3, RMON 9, Telnet, SNMP 3, SNMP 2c, HTTPS, TFTP, SSH-2, CLI, SNMP 6, NTP, ICMP, RADIUS

Compliant Standards
- IEEE 802.3, IEEE 802.3u, IEEE 802.3i, IEEE 802.3z, IEEE 802.1D, IEEE 802.1Q, IEEE 802.3ab, IEEE 802.1p, IEEE 802.3x, IEEE 802.3ad (LACP), IEEE 802.1w, IEEE 802.1x, IEEE 802.3ae, IEEE 802.3ac, IEEE 802.1s, IEEE 802.1ad, IEEE 802.3ah, IEEE 802.1v, ANSI/TIA-1057, IEEE 802.1AE, IEEE 802.1AB (LLDP), IEEE 802.1ak, IEEE 802.3az, IEEE 802.1ax, IEEE 802.1R
Memory
- RAM: 2 GB SDRAM
- Flash Memory: 512 MB
Expansion/Connectivity
- Interfaces:
- 48 x 1000Base-T RJ-45
- 4 x 10Gbit LAN SFP+
- 1 x Console RJ-45 Management
- 1 x Mini-USB Management
- 1 x Management RJ-45
- 1 x USB 2.0
Power
- Power Device: Internal Power Supply (not installed)
- Max Supported Quantity: 2
- Power Consumption Standby: 40 Watts
